Maxx Crosby signs record $106.5M extension with Raiders

Maxx Crosby has signed a record-breaking three-year, $106.5 million contract extension with the Las Vegas Raiders, making him the highest-paid non-quarterback in NFL history, with $91.5 million guaranteed. The deal ties Crosby, a four-time Pro Bowl selection, to the team through 2029 and comes as the Raiders undergo significant organizational changes under minority owner Tom Brady. Crosby's impressive stats include 59.5 sacks over six seasons, placing him among the top pass-rushers in the league. His contract may set a precedent for other star defensive players seeking extensions, like Micah Parsons and T.J. Watt. Despite frustrations with the team's performance, Crosby expressed a desire to remain with the Raiders and hopes for a strong future, especially after the hiring of new head coach Pete Carroll. The Raiders are also well-positioned in free agency with substantial cap space available.
